AP Environmental Science got to tour Headquarters, in Anderson and learned about how they sustainably manage forests and are the largest private landowners in the US. They toured their Sawmill, Fabrication, Engineering and Cogeneration facility. They produce their own electricity using sawmill waste with zero emissions!
